Heat Interface Units

For homes fed with heat from a heat network, the Baxi AquaHeat HI/HWI (Heating Indirect/Hot Water Indirect)is the answer to your apartment’s heating and hot water requirements.


The Baxi AquaHeat HD/HWI (Heating Direct/Hot Water Indirect) provides an alternative highly efficient, low cost solution and the Baxi AquaHeat HI (Heating Indirect) is perfectly suited to supply heat to communal and commercial premises in your development.

Features and Benefits

Multiple outputs

Range of heating outputs from 4kW to 60kW and domestic hot water outputs from 18kW to 57kW.

Easy installation

Optional first fix rail with in-built filling loop and stand-off bracket to allow for installation with various primary and tertiary pipework. Pre-wired with heat meter and Mercurius remote monitoring module.

Highly efficient

Ultra-fast acting, fully modulating PICV perfectly matches energy supply to instantaneous demand and high performance insulation providing very low heat losses.

Remote monitoring and control

Mercurius platform for remote monitoring to reduce site on time and giving visibility of errors to improve first-time fix rates.

Reliable

Water Regulation WRAS and Reg4 approved. BESA 2023 V3 compliant in preparation for HNTAS market regulation. Covered with a 5-year parts and labour warranty.*

BESA 2023 V3 accredited

High performing Indirect HIU with 8 best practice passes. The first BESA 2023 certified Direct HIU with best practice Heat Loss performance.
